What is the present tense of encrusted?

What's the present tense of encrusted? Here's the word you're looking for.

Answer

The present tense of encrusted is encrust.

The third-person singular simple present indicative form of encrust is encrusts.

The present participle of encrust is encrusting.

The past participle of encrust is encrusted.

Examples
Salt crystals encrust your shoes and coat your pants cuffs, and you begin to think your own cells are turning to salt.
Zebra mussels encrust any solid structures in the water and block water pipes.
For some time, he seems to have been growing dissatisfied with the gradualist, uniformitarian patina which had grown to encrust evolutionary theory.
An engine's heat melts the fine-ground rock, which proceeds to encrust the cooler parts of the mechanism, stopping it from working.
I was an instant behind myself: I saw what it all was, but the thought could not encrust itself with meaning.
Well-studied examples occur in the hydractiniid hydroids, which encrust hard substrata with stolons that serve as tube-like connections between feeding polyps.
